The Bluebells are a Scottish pop band best known for their jangly guitar melodies and catchy tunes. Formed in the early 1980s, they rose to prominence with hits like "Young at Heart," which topped the UK charts in 1993 when it was re-released. Their debut album, Sisters, features other popular tracks like "Cath" and "I'm Falling", cementing their place in the indie-pop scene.
The Bluebells have played at nostalgic festivals like Rewind and Let's Rock, where their timeless sound continues to resonate with both original fans and new listeners. Their live performances capture the joyful energy of 80s pop, ensuring The Bluebells' lasting appeal in the UK’s music landscape.
